Solid Particle Movement Simulation in a Quiescent Container Based on Discrete Element Method Using CFDEM

Summary

This study used the Discrete Element Method to simulate how solid particles, including microplastics, move through still water, modeling the physics of their settling and transport behavior. Accurate movement simulations help scientists predict where microplastics accumulate in aquatic environments, informing cleanup strategies and exposure assessments.
